    Bukom Banku, Nikki Samonas to star in upcoming film ‘Hero’s Ride – Baby Thief’

    Celebrated Ghanaian actress, Nikki Samonas, and popular media personality and boxer, Bukom Banku, are among the headline stars in a gripping new action-comedy film titled ‘Hero’s Ride – Baby Thief.’

    The film brings together an impressive cast, including Gloria Sarfo, Andrew Adote, and Ben Affat, in a thrilling tale of crime, courage, and community justice.

    In this latest project by AI Media Limited, the boxer, Bukom Banku, known for his charismatic presence and comedic flair, also brings his unique energy to the screen, making this his first major movie role.

    ‘Hero’s Ride – Baby Thief’ follows the story of Ben, a clever Bolt driver who gets caught up in a criminal plot involving a stolen baby.

    As events spiral out of control, he teams up with his friends from the local taxi station — played by the dynamic supporting cast — to take on a dangerous child trafficking ring.

    Beyond its entertainment value, the film will delve into serious social issues, using wit and action to spotlight the dangers of child theft and the everyday heroes who fight against such crimes.

    According to AI Media’s Managing Director, Kwame Boadi, the project “brings together an exceptional cast and a fascinating story in a bold collaboration with PETROSOL.”

    The film will also be adapted into a six-part online series to increase accessibility and reach a wider digital audience.
